Machakos Governor Alfred Mutua claims his 2022 presidential ambition has earned him enemies.

Speaking at Mbiuni in Mwala sub-county on Saturday, Mutua said most of the leaders fighting him are against his presidential bid.

Mutua said he hasn't been able to diligently discharge his duties as a governor due to his political nemesis who is bent on frustrating his leadership.

"Even the MCAs are now fighting not to mention the speaker who has chosen to indulge in politics. She is receiving calls from the 'above' and told to ensure I don't perform in Machakos," Mutua said.

He said he won't stop his quest to lead the country stating that anyone fighting him is an enemy of development.

"I have a lot of plans for Machakos people beginning with the youths, farmers, women, and children. I want to ensure they become self-reliant, the youths to have money in their pockets and farmers to be able to sell farm produces abroad," Mutua added.

Mutua criticized the area MCA Joseph Wambua for failing to accompany him in his tour despite being in his ward.

"The MCA's failure to show up during my tour is the same as me failing to turn up when President Uhuru Kenyatta visits Machakos County," Mutua said.
